AC Milan are on the hunt for a sporting director, and the process is taking a bit too long for some, leading Andrea Longoni to speak about the situation this morning.
The mercato activities in recent years have left the majority of Milan fans feeling overly frustrated. The Rossoneri have often wasted money on poor talents, whilst failing to land their big targets, often seeing them go to other clubs.
So this summer, a new route is being taken, and it starts with a new sporting director, who will arrive to oversee the new project. However, there has not been much progress made towards appointing the arriving senior figure.
Fabio Paratici was the expected incoming, but later changes ruled out that move. So, the Diavolo are back on the prowl, and Longoni has looked at the situation as it currently is, and he has highlighted one candidate for Milan News.
“Furlani should tighten the circle and come to a final decision very quickly, too much has already been lost. The easiest one is called Igli Tare, the only one among the candidates not currently committed to a club.

“The most fascinating one leads instead to Giovanni Sartori: creator of the miracles first Chievo, then Atalanta and Bologna. The current director of the Rossoblu would put everyone in agreement, even the vast majority of the Rossoneri people who watch, incredulous, the casting.
“We need to understand, quickly, if, despite the recent renewal with Bologna, Sartori can be freed to make the crowning achievement of a splendid career, but one that has never seen him at a top club like AC Milan.
“If not, divert to Tare and try to make a quick start again. The Rossoneri are the club that will have to work harder and better next season to try and get back on track. So head down and work, but competently…”
